The next thing i did. My sister gave me this old worn out looking ugly brown foyer table that my parents had given her...and we had this table all growing up too. It had two glass squares on top that you can take off to clean and just place back on when your done. Well, i bought a sample of black paint for like $3.00 b/c that is all i needed. Painted it black. We already had the paint brushes. Then i found some tiles that were on sale at Home Depot and had them cut to the measurements i needed and replaced the glass on the table with tiles. So, this table only cost me about seven bucks. Now i just need to figure out what i am going to put on it. I am also going to sand it down a little to give it a little antique look. Fun, huh!?
